We work at Long Reach regularly, and river operations are the core of what we do. That combination of aviation and marine crew is what makes over-water work practical rather than theoretical. Small jobs are welcome; a single vessel pass is as valid a brief as a week of coverage.

Magnetic interference near steel structures at Long Reach is factored into the flight plan. Dual-operator setups let the pilot hold visual line of sight while the camera tracks independently. Battery and crew changes are planned around the window so nothing is lost mid-sequence.

Our crews hold marine VHF and stay in contact with river traffic while the aircraft is airborne. Documentation is available up front: permissions, marine insurance and the risk assessment. If wind or river conditions turn on the day, the pilot's call is final.

Deliverables come in the format your editorial or engineering team already works in. Talk to our skippers before you commit. They will tell you quickly whether the shot is achievable. We can hold a provisional tide window while you confirm internally.

How does the tide affect a shoot at Long Reach?

Tide decides what is visible, what is navigable and where we can launch and recover. We plan Long Reach operations around the tide table first and build the shot list around the window that gives you the best water.

Do you work with the vessel operator directly?

Yes, and it makes a noticeable difference to the result. Given the skipper's contact we coordinate the passage and the shot list directly, so the vessel is where the camera needs it rather than the other way round.

Who owns the footage from the Long Reach shoot?

Licensing is agreed before the flight and written into the quote. Tell us whether the material is for broadcast, marketing, an operational record or a planning submission and we scope the licence accordingly.
